Quick note on night shifts at Ostrander Labs: the support team often rolls in after 22:00, when the main doors are locked and reception is empty. That's totally fine — just come round to the east entrance by the bike shed and let yourself in. The keypad by the door takes the night-access code shown below.

door code, yagap-bahof: bdg-O-05

Management Meeting Minutes — Supplier Renewal

Present: heads of ops, procurement, finance (Pellworth Foods).

Quick one: the Garnock Packaging contract is up in March. Their quote is 7% higher; procurement thinks 4% is achievable given volumes. Agreed to counter next week and hold a fallback chat with Ilsmere Containers. Ops confirmed no switching risk before summer. Decision due at the next meeting. Background on why timing matters is set out below.

management briefing: Project Ulavan slips by two quarters because of the staffing delay.

## Local Setup: Timezone Handling

Reportly exports render timestamps in the requesting user's timezone, but all rows are stored in UTC. Conversion happens in the export worker, not the database, so discrepancies usually mean a stale tzdata bundle — run `make tzupdate` to refresh it. Start the worker with `make export-worker` and generate a test report via the CLI. The worker reads schedule rows and user timezone preferences from Postgres; configure access with the connection string below.

replica DSN, tawef-hahap: mysql://eliix_svc:FiIC0jz@db-394a.lumiclabs.internal:5432/holius